Fat SacksI’ve got some fat sacks. You know you want some. I picked up 3 bags of Breiss 2-row Brewer’s malt from HDYB today - Joe cut me a deal since I bought 3 at a time. Add that to the sack of pilsner and 1/2 sack of Maris Otter - I gots the goods.

Peated ScottishMy peated scottish brewed on Sunday is winding down… just in time for a 20 gallon batch this weekend of American Brown Ale with my buddy Brian. The sack of Weyermann Pilsner comes courtesy of Brian as well - Thanks a ton, man. Very cool. We’ll use the rest of the Maris Otter (top bag - about 25 lbs left in there) with a portion of Briess 2-Row Brewer’s malt this weekend, repitching yeast from our batch of Saturday IPA a few weeks ago. This batch won’t use nearly the hop bill the last one did - I think right now we’re only looking at 6 or 7 ounces for 20 gallons, whereas we used 24 oz in that IPA.
